Well, a little later than planned but it's time to start making some notes about the ATW800/2 board that is now installed in one of my Mega ST4s.

As always, time has been limited so I've not got much farther than fitting the card and using it to run TOS 2.06, install an SD card as a hard drive and revel in a 1920x1080x256 display.

The TRAM I was planning to fit is too big to go inside the case of the Mega so that's currently on hold (as is fitting the battery to use with the RTC until I buy a CR2032)...

I've had a very positive impression of the whole project so far and hope to get the s/w transferred onto the hard drive and then experiment with the Transputer functionality.

Some screenshots of mine running on my TT, I've got 2x T800 TRAM's with 4mb memory each installed.

FYI try not to run crazy resolutions, as most transputer software including Helios expects 1024x768x256.

mrbombermillzy wrote: 24 May 2025 20:18 I dont see more than 1600x1200 as a resolution option on mine. What gives? :lol:
He must have booted off the floppy and not used the driver's from the repo. The floppy accidentally had beta drivers on. Those high resolutions were removed because they're buggy, can cause slow down of the entire FPGA, or cause instability.
